Introduction to KnowledgeGrapher
KnowledgeGrapher is an advanced AI-powered tool designed to assist users in constructing and visualizing complex knowledge graphs. Its primary purpose is to enable users to explore intricate relationships between entities—such as people, organizations, places, concepts, and events—by organizing this information into a graph format. The key feature of KnowledgeGrapher lies in its ability to process and connect data across diverse domains, presenting it in a way that is easy to understand and analyze. The graphs produced by KnowledgeGrapher are visual and interactive, allowing users to see how concepts or entities relate to one another, making it easier to identify trends, outliers, and key insights. **Example**: A user looking to understand the relationships between tech companies, their founders, and notable products could input data such as companies like Apple, Google, and Microsoft, and see how they connect to their founders, key employees, and products. KnowledgeGrapher would structure these into a graph, highlighting the interconnectedness of these entities and offering a clear visual representation. In summary, KnowledgeGrapher's primary function is to extract knowledge from disparate data sources and arrange it into clear, meaningful relationships within a graph, facilitating insights and decision-making.

Knowledge Graph Visualization
Example
KnowledgeGrapher transforms raw data into a visual representation in the form of a graph, with nodes representing entities and edges showing the relationships between them. This can include hierarchical structures, cause-effect chains, or social networks. For instance, a business analyst looking to track the partnerships between various companies in the tech industry can use KnowledgeGrapher to visually map these connections.
Scenario
A supply chain manager uses KnowledgeGrapher to visualize the flow of products from suppliers to manufacturers to retailers. The nodes would represent each entity in the supply chain, and the edges would depict the transactions, partnerships, or logistics that connect them. This helps to quickly identify bottlenecks or inefficiencies in the system.

What are the benefits of using a knowledge graph over a traditional search engine?
Unlike traditional search engines that provide isolated results, KnowledgeGrapher presents the information in a connected, visual format. This allows users to explore the relationships between concepts, entities, and facts in a more comprehensive and intuitive way, facilitating a deeper understanding of complex topics.
